Output 590c91bcd15c8940299f61cc9d13e1f0bb17403f98cd0d3f3f67a6999b0ba9ca:1

value
1095601
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bbfa9eea980f1fcd4e68058dd9402b3cfe3fe09b OP_EQUALVERIFY OP_CHECKSIG
address
1J8wbJtgRT2AnHBmBVDFhHWf35mZCTZ9dx
transaction
590c91bcd15c8940299f61cc9d13e1f0bb17403f98cd0d3f3f67a6999b0ba9ca
confirmations
279015
spent
true